Annotation and Research Collaboration Tool(EDM 샘플 응용 프로그램)

온라인으로 리서치를 수행하면 다수의 웹 페이지 참조뿐만 아니라 다양한 항목과 관련된 사람의 연락처 정보 항목을 접하게 되는 경우가 자주 있습니다. 생성된 이러한 정보를 추적하는 일이 데이터 관리 작업이며, 이 작업은 EDM(엔터티 데이터 모델)을 기반으로 하는 응용 프로그램에서 엔터티 및 연결을 사용하여 단순화할 수 있습니다.

Research Collaboration Tool을 사용하면 항목이나 검색 텍스트와 관련된 사람뿐만 아니라 관련 웹 페이지에 대해 검색할 수 있는 참조 주석 및 연락처 엔터티를 만들어 리서치와 공동 작업을 지원할 수 있습니다.

이 응용 프로그램은 웹 페이지 참조, 참조 설명자, 연락처 정보 등을 나타내는 엔터티를 구현합니다. 하나의 EDM 연결은 웹 페이지 참조와 참조 설명자를 연결하도록 정의되고, 다대다 연결로 정의되는 두 번째 연결은 사용자가 참조 항목과 관련하여 추가로 공동 작업을 원하는 대상자의 연락처 정보를 웹 페이지 참조와 연결하는 데 사용됩니다.

다음 4가지 엔터티가 이 응용 프로그램에서 사용됩니다.

  • Reference

  • ReferenceDescriptor

  • ContactPerson

  • ContactPersonReference(링크 테이블 엔터티)

참조를 주석 및 연락처와 연결하는 데 다음 연결이 사용됩니다.

  • ReferenceDescriptor_Reference

  • LinkTable_ContactPerson

  • LinkTable_Reference

다음 UI 표시에서는 실행 중인 응용 프로그램을 보여 줍니다. 검색 구문 텍스트 상자에 "directx"를 입력한 후 Find 단추를 클릭하여 주석 및 관련된 연락처 목록이 표시된 상태입니다. 검색 항목에 있는 웹 페이지 링크를 클릭하면 참조된 웹 페이지를 브라우저에 표시할 수 있습니다. UI에서 표시된 링크를 클릭하여 참조 URL을 웹 브라우저에 표시했습니다. Find Ref Person 단추를 사용하여 유사한 쿼리를 실행하면 항목 필드별이 아니라 연락처별로 정렬된 결과가 반환됩니다.

리서치 공동 작업 도구 UI

웹 페이지에 주석을 달려면 페이지를 연 다음 키워드 텍스트 상자에 키워드를 추가하거나 입력/출력 텍스트 영역에 주석을 추가합니다. Create Ref 단추를 클릭합니다.

웹 페이지에 정보를 연결하려면 페이지를 연 다음 성, 이름, 직위, 전자 메일 텍스트 상자에 연락처 정보를 입력합니다. Create Ref Person을 클릭합니다.

이 응용 프로그램은 SQL Server Compact 3.5 데이터베이스에 구현된 저장소에 대해 매우 원활히 작동합니다. 데이터가 다수의 SQL Server Compact 3.5 설치에서 동기화되어 여러 사용자가 함께 사용할 수 있으며, 응용 프로그램을 네트워크 사용자가 사용할 수 있도록 SQL Server에 대해 실행할 수도 있습니다.

이 데이터 모델에서 사용되는 스키마와 응용 프로그램 코드에 대한 자세한 내용은 Annotation Research Tool 스키마(EDM 샘플 응용 프로그램)Annotation Research Tool 응용 프로그램 코드(EDM 샘플 응용 프로그램)를 참조하십시오.

참고 항목

개념

Annotation Research Tool 스키마(EDM 샘플 응용 프로그램)
Annotation Research Tool 응용 프로그램 코드(EDM 샘플 응용 프로그램)
엔터티 구현(EDM)

기타 리소스

EDM 사양
스키마 및 매핑 사양(Entity Framework)